ACH580-01-089A-4 ABB 45kW Three Phase ABB ACH580 Variable Speed Drive
ABB ACH580-01-089A-4 HVAC variable frequency drive, a 45 kW three-phase AC drive designed for efficient motor control of fans, pumps, compressors and commercial HVAC systems.
The ABB ACH580-01-089A-4 is a high-performance AC variable frequency drive (VFD) engineered for efficient speed control of three-phase motors in heating, ventilation and air conditioning systems. As part of the advanced ABB ACH580 HVAC drive series, it has been specifically developed to deliver reliable operation, simplified commissioning and exceptional energy efficiency for commercial and industrial building services.
Designed with dedicated HVAC functionality, the ACH580 includes integrated application macros, intelligent motor control, built-in communication options and an intuitive assistant control panel. These features reduce engineering time while improving system performance, making it an ideal solution for consultants, contractors and facilities managers.
With a rated output power of 45 kW, a nominal output current of 89 A and a three-phase 380-480 V AC supply, the ACH580-01-089A-4 is perfectly suited to controlling large fans, pumps, compressors, air handling units and chiller systems. Its compact wall-mounted design enables fast installation within plant rooms and electrical control panels.

Efficient HVAC Motor Control
Variable frequency drives such as the ABB ACH580 continuously regulate motor speed by adjusting voltage and frequency to match system demand. This significantly reduces energy consumption while improving comfort, extending equipment life and lowering maintenance costs.
The ACH580 series has been developed specifically for HVAC engineers and building management professionals. Its integrated application features simplify installation while supporting efficient operation across both standard and mission-critical HVAC installations.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the ABB ACH580-01-089A-4 used for?
The drive provides energy-efficient speed control for three-phase motors used in HVAC systems including fans, pumps, compressors and air handling units.
What motor size is supported?
The ACH580-01-089A-4 is designed for motors with a rated output power of up to 45 kW.
What input supply does this drive require?
The drive operates from a three-phase 380-480 V AC power supply.
Does the drive include built-in safety features?
Yes. It includes integrated Safe Torque Off (STO) functionality together with comprehensive HVAC control features.
Where is the ACH580-01-089A-4 typically installed?
It is commonly installed within HVAC plant rooms, electrical switchrooms and commercial building management systems controlling pumps, fans and air handling equipment.
